Rich Smith, The Motley Fool Tue, June 30, 2026 at 12:09 AM GMT+7 3 min read MU NVDA AAPL SNDK Micron (NASDAQ: MU) stock slipped 2% through 12:35 p.m. ET Monday as even more worries about the durability of demand for DRAM and NAND computer memory surfaced.
Perennial Micron bull Jordan Klein at Mizuho is doing his best to contain the damage with a note in support of Micron today... but it seems to be having limited effect.
